管理员管理
版本: 1.0
目标:
管理员管理模块是 TGM.Bet 平台的重要管理工具,用于控制和管理所有后台管理员的权限、操作记录及活动状态。该模块确保后台管理操作的安全性和透明度,防止未经授权的访问和操作,同时提供管理员权限分配及操作记录的审计功能。
1. 功能需求
1.1 管理员账户管理
管理员账户管理用于创建、编辑和删除平台的后台管理员账户,并为每个管理员分配相应的权限和角色。
管理员账户创建:
系统支持创建新的管理员账户,要求输入用户名、邮箱、初始密码及分配的角色。
系统自动发送邮件通知新管理员进行账户激活和初始登录。
编辑管理员信息:
管理员可以通过系统修改现有管理员的账户信息,包括用户名、邮箱、权限分配等。
支持密码重置功能,管理员可以通过邮件发送密码重置链接。
删除管理员:
系统允许超级管理员或具有权限的管理员删除现有管理员账户。
删除账户时,系统会记录该操作并保存日志以供审计。
管理员角色分配:
系统支持为每个管理员分配不同的角色,如超级管理员、财务管理员、游戏管理员等。
每个角色具有不同的操作权限,角色权限可以定制,确保管理员仅能访问与其职责相关的模块。
管理员启用/禁用:
管理员可以启用或禁用某个管理员账户,禁用账户后该管理员无法再访问系统。
1.2 管理员权限管理
权限管理模块用于控制每个管理员的操作权限,以保证平台的安全性和控制操作范围。
权限分配:
支持按模块分配权限,包括用户管理、资金管理、游戏管理、返佣管理、报表查看等。
管理员可以自定义权限模板,以便快速为新管理员分配权限。
角色权限控制:
系统提供预定义角色权限(如超级管理员、游戏管理员、财务管理员等),超级管理员可以编辑每个角色的权限配置。
自定义权限设置:
支持管理员自定义权限,通过勾选不同操作项(如查看、编辑、删除等)灵活控制每个管理员的操作权限。
1.3 管理员操作日志
操作日志模块记录所有管理员在后台的操作,确保操作过程的透明性和可追溯性。
操作日志记录:
系统记录每个管理员的所有操作,包括登录时间、修改账户信息、资金处理、游戏管理等操作。
日志搜索与过滤:
管理员可以通过时间段、操作类型、操作人等条件搜索操作日志,方便进行审计。
日志导出:
系统支持将操作日志导出为 CSV 或 PDF 格式,便于平台进行定期审计和数据分析。
日志保存周期:
超级管理员可以设置日志的保存周期,确保关键操作记录的长期保留和审计需要。
1.4 管理员登录安全
登录安全模块确保管理员账户的登录安全性,防止未授权访问和账户被盗。
双因素认证(2FA):
系统支持为管理员账户启用双因素认证(2FA),通过短信或 Google Authenticator 提供额外的安全层。
登录IP限制:
管理员可以为后台账户设置允许登录的 IP 地址范围,限制非授权设备的访问。
多设备登录管理:
系统允许超级管理员查看管理员的设备登录情况,并远程退出未授权的登录会话。
登录历史记录:
记录每个管理员的登录历史,包括登录时间、登录IP地址及设备信息,管理员可以随时查看账户的登录情况。
1.5 操作审核与通知
操作审核与通知模块用于关键操作的审核流程管理,并确保平台运营的透明性。
操作审批流程:
对于资金操作、用户状态更改等关键操作,系统可以配置审批流程。操作需由多名管理员审核通过后方可执行。
操作通知与提醒:
管理员在执行重要操作(如提现审批、返佣发放等)时,系统会发送通知或提醒,确保操作流程的透明性。
安全提醒:
当检测到异常登录、操作失败或其他潜在风险时,系统自动向管理员发送安全提醒,并记录详细日志。
2. 交互需求
2.1 用户端交互
无用户端交互:该模块仅限于后台管理系统,普通用户无法访问。
2.2 后台管理交互
管理员账户管理:通过专属界面创建、编辑和删除管理员账户,分配相应权限。
操作日志查看:管理员可以查看所有操作日志,并通过筛选条件进行数据分析和审计。
权限配置界面:提供清晰的权限分配界面,支持自定义权限设置,方便管理不同管理员的操作权限。
3. 系统需求
3.1 数据安全性
数据加密:管理员的账户信息和权限数据需要通过加密方式存储和传输,确保安全性。
权限控制:系统需确保每个管理员只能访问和操作其分配权限内的模块,防止未经授权的操作。
3.2 审计追踪
全面的操作记录:所有管理员的操作记录都必须详尽保存,便于审计和合规管理。
日志管理扩展性:系统应具备对日志进行长期存储及灵活查询的能力,确保能够应对大规模日志数据需求。
3.3 性能需求
高并发支持:管理员管理模块需支持多个管理员同时登录和操作,确保后台管理流畅运行。
3.4 系统扩展性
多层级权限支持:系统需支持添加新的角色和权限模板,便于随时扩展后台权限控制。
4. 非功能需求
4.1 性能需求
高并发处理:模块需支持多个管理员同时操作,确保系统高效运行。
4.2 安全需求
数据加密与保护:管理员账户数据及操作日志需要进行加密处理,防止未经授权访问。
4.3 扩展性
权限可扩展性:平台管理员可根据业务需求,自定义权限模板,灵活扩展管理范围。
5. 总结
管理员管理模块通过对后台管理员账户的细致权限分配、操作日志追踪、双因素认证等多层次的管理手段,确保 TGM.Bet 平台的后台操作安全性与透明性。通过多级权限设置和操作日志审计功能,平台能够有效控制后台操作风险,防止潜在安全隐患,并保证平台的稳定运营。
Last updated